This is a Notice of Intent published in accordance with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) 5.101(a)(1) requiring the dissemination of information regarding proposed contract actions. This Notice of Intent is for a proposed award of a sole source firm fixed price contract to the following contractor in support of National Criminal Information Center (NCIC) Data Base in support of Omaha VA Health Care System, 4101 Woolworth, Omaha, NE 68105-1850:

Nebraska Dept of Administrative Services SAM UEI: JE62CSD5KGJ6 1526 K Street, Ste 190 Lincoln, NE 68508 This is done under authority of 41 U.S.C. 3304(a)(1), as implemented by FAR 6.302-1: Only one source and no other supplies or services will satisfy agency requirements. This is not a request for competitive quotes. Market research revealed that Nebraska Dept of Administrative Services is the sole service provider for the NCIC database currently being utilized by Omaha VA Health Care System.

VA requires the NCIC service provided by the Nebraska Dept of Administrative Services for criminal history, sex offender, and missing persons searches to ensure the safety of the veterans. The North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) code for this service is 922190 (Other Justice, Public Order, and Safety Activities) and the Product Service Code (PSC) is R615 (Support Administrative Background Investigation.).
